The 65-bell bianzhong can be seen at the Provincial Museum of
Hubei in the Central China city of Wuhan.
Another trianzhong worth seeing is one of the 16 bells made of
pure gold during the Qianiong period in the 18
th
century, now
displayed in the Forbidden Citys Hall of Treasures. Cast in unique
forms and about the same size, the 16 bells are of a uniform height of
23.8 centimetres, but their ranges from 4,703 to 14,316 grams. Round
in shape, they produce a rather monotonous ring, but they were meant
during the heyday of the Qirig Dynasty, to impress viewers with the
wealth and extravagance of the imperial house. And they are indeed
very much valued, being cast in dazzling gold and engraved with
lively terns of ball-playing dragons.
